Under shelter of the night, a hooded teenager with a can of spray paint climbs up the flyover over a motorway. The boy is seen by the police, who start to chase him, but he manages to escape. At home, in the morning, he is woken up by his mother. Is this yet another film about a young hoodlum and rebel or insolent anarchist? The director and screenwriter, Patrice Laliberté, has a much more interesting story to tell. Reported with precision and authenticity, this drama escapes stereotypes and is deeply moving.
